Table of Contents"The Canadian Battlefields in Italy: The Gothic Line and the Battle of the Rivers by Eric McGeer with Matt Symes The Gothic Line Introduction The Gothic Line Background History To the Threshold of the Gothic Line Breaking the Gothic Line Breaking Green II The Rimini Line The Tour Tour 1—To the Threshold of the Gothic Line Tour 2—Breaking the Gothic Line Tour 3—Breaking Green II Tour 4—The Rimini Line The Battle of the Rivers Introduction The Battle of the Rivers History The Advance to the Lamone (Operation """"Chuckle"""") From the Lamone to the Canale Naviglio To the Senio The Tour Tour 1—The Advance to the Lamone (Operation """"Chuckle"""") Tour 2—From the Lamone to the Canale Naviglio Tour 3—To the Senio Additional Information Travel Information Suggestions for further reading Canadian Order of Battle Epilogue"ReviewsAuthor InformationEric McGeer holds a PhD from the Université de Montréal and teaches at St. Clement's School in Toronto. He is the author of Words of Valediction and Remembrance: Canadian Epitaphs of the Second World War and several books on warfare and law in ancient Byzantium. Matt Symes has worked and taught extensively on the history of war and memory and is co-author of five battlefield guidebooks, including Canadian Battlefields 1915-1918: A Visitor's Guide.
